TheraSphere® (Yttrium-90) on Hepatocellular Carcinoma (HCC)


Introduction

TheraSphere® is Yttrium-90 microspheres radioembolization useful for liver cancer treatment and used generally to treat patients with hepatocellular carcinoma (HCC) and liver metastases (1).  In this paper, we become to discuss it, how to activate Yttrium-90 on the hepatocellular carcinoma, information of nuclide, radiation and the half-life. We also will analyze physiological features of Yttrium-90 on hepatocellular carcinoma cells and its side effects on the patient.

How to activate Yttrium-90 on hepatocellular carcinoma

TheraSphere (Yttrium-90 microspheres) are radioactive particles as a form of radiation treatment for unresectable HCC. TheraSphere is supplied in 0.5 mL of sterile, pyrogen-free water contained in a 0.3-mL V-bottom vial secured within a 12-mm clear acrylic vial shield. Yttrium-90 microspheres are administered by intra-arterial hepatic injection preferentially flow to tumor (Figure 1.), to patients with unresectable HCC who can have appropriately positioned hepatic arterial catheters (2).

           

Figure 1. Yttrium-90 microspheres are injected into the hepatic arteries preferentially flow to tumor (5).

The Yttrium-90 microspheres are trapped in tumors at the precapillary alveolar level. Patients can be released after infusion of the microspheres, since the Yttrium-90 decays only by beta-emission. Beta radiation is delivered internally to tumor at site of active growth. After administration, the bremsstrahlung radiation (electromagnetic radiation) is produced from the beta minus-interaction in the body, can be imaged and used to determine qualitative distribution in the liver (1).
A suspension of appropriately calibrated Yttrium-90 microspheres injected via the hepatic artery preferentially lodge in the peritumoral vessels, a process termed embolization, by which tumors are deprived of their nutrient arterial supply (3).

Information of nuclide, radiation and half-life

TheraSphere consists of nonbiodegradable glass microspheres (mean diameter of 25 μm) with yttrium-90 as an integral constituent of the glass. Yttrium-90 have the element´s atomic number (Z=39) and number of neutrons (N=51) and the atomic mass (A=90) (1).  Yttrium-90 is a pure beta emitted radionuclide, produced by neutron and decays to stable zirconium-90 with a physical half-life of 64.1 hours (2.67 days). The average energy of beta emission from the yttrium-90 is 0.9367 MeV, with a mean tissue penetration of 2.5 mm and a maximum of 10 mm (2).

One gigabecquerel (1GBq or 27mCi) delivers a total absorbed radiation dose of 50Gy/kg of tissue or per kilogram of targeted liver tissue provides a dose of 50Gy. In therapeutic use, in which the isotope decays to infinity, 94% of the radiation is delivered in 11 days (3).

Physiological Features of Yttrium-90 Microsphere

TheraSphere (MDS Nordion, Ottawa, Ontario, Canada) consists of millions of microscopic, radioactive glass Yttrium-90 microspheres (20–30 micrometers in diameter) with yttrium-90 as an integral constituent of the glass (3). The Yttrium-90 microspheres are not biodegradable; they decay only by a pure beta-emission, produced by neutron bombardment of Yttrium-90 in a reactor with a mean tissue penetration of 2.5 mm (2).

The Yttrium-90 microsphere is a high energy beta-emitter, would create a zone of radiation exposure confined to the vicinity of the tumor while maintaining nontumorous hepatic parenchymal exposure to tolerable levels. This forms the premise for radioembolization, also known as selective internal radiation therapy or microsphere brachytherapy (3). In clinical practice, millions of microspheres, measuring 30 micrometers in diameter incorporating yttrium-90, are injected via an intra-arterial catheter to the hepatic arterial supply of the tumor (3).

In patients with non-compromised liver function, the liver can tolerate 30 to 35Gy (1Gy represents the energy absorbed from ionizing radiation equal to 1 J/kg of tissue) when it is presented via uniform radiation fields with conventional fractionation (2).

           Yttrium-90 microspheres can be delivered in a local as segmental or sub-segmental, regional (lobar via the left or right hepatic artery), or whole-liver (via proper hepatic artery) manner, resulting in high radiation doses to arterial-fed tumors while sparing the liver parenchyma, which receives most of its blood supply from the portal vein. This method of radiation treatment provides a safety margin by distributing the radiation in a partial liver volume while treating tumors with tumoricidal doses of radiation. Yttrium-90 microsphere injection provides millions of scattered point sources of radioactivity, as opposed to the uniform fields of external beam radiotherapy. This difference in field properties for a given measure of radiation absorbed dose results in different biological effects (2).

The Side effects

Radioembolization is not without complications; it may lead to post-radioembolization syndrome which includes fatigue, nausea, vomiting, anorexia, fever, abdominal pain and cachexia. More serious adverse events include radiation induced liver toxicity, vascular injury when introducing the catheter, radiation pneumonitis from microspheres shunting around the liver and into the lungs, and gastrointestinal tract ulceration (4).

Absolute contraindications for the use of 90Y microspheres include pretreatment with 99mTc macroaggregated albumin scan demonstrating significant hepatopulmonary shunts, and inability to prevent deposition of the microspheres to the gastrointestinal tract with modern catheter techniques (4).

Pulmonary Arterial Hypertensions in Infants


Sildenafil (viagra) in infants


Sildenafil in the treatment of pulmonary arterial hypertension in infants ...
.--------------------------------------------------------------------------------------------------------
.
Definition
------------
.
.
Pulmonary arterial hypertension(PAH) is a progressive, and often fatal, debilitating disorder.
The increased pulmonary artery pressure found in PAH is due to disturbances in key vascular mediator pathways including relative deficiencies of vasodilators such as nitric oxide (NO) and prostacyclin, as well as exaggerated production of vasoconstrictors such as endothelin and thromboxanes.
.
.
Symptoms
-------------
.
.
Progressive breathlessness, exertion limitation, frequent decline and failure of the right ventricle.
.
.
Mechanism of action of sildenafil
----------------------------------------
.
.
Sildenafil is a selective inhibitor of phosphodiesterase type 5 (PDE5). Present throughout the body, PDE5 is found in high concentrations in the lungs. Inhibition of PDE5 enhances the vasodilatory effects of nitric oxide in pulmonary hypertension by preventing the degradation of cyclic guanosine monophosphate (cGMP), which promotes relaxation of vascular smooth muscle and increases blood flow. In animal models and human trials, sildenafil has been found to produce a relatively selective reduction in pulmonary artery pressure without adverse systemic hemodynamic effects after 3 months of oral therapy. Inhibition of PDE5 by sildenafil may also enhance the platelet antiaggregatory activity of nitric oxide and inhibit thrombus formation.

Aloe Vera Plant Benefits

Aloe Vera is a succulent plant known for its healing, medicinal properties. For topical use, the leaf is sliced open and the pulp from within is used for application. Among the many forms it is used in, aloe vera juice and aloe vera gel are the most popular. Aloe Vera is often considered a wonder plant, and people claim its assistance in curing just about any ailment.
 


Aloe vera plant has the capacity to treat following ailments:

Constipation: Constipation is treated with orally consumed dried latex that is taken from the inner lining of aloe leaves. The laxative properties of a substance called aloin contained in the aloe vera plant, is supported by scientific evidence. A large number of herbal remedies that treat constipation contain aloe vera extracts.

Genital herpes: A few studies have suggested that Aloe vera extracts in a hydrophilic cream may be effective in treating genital herpes in men. This combination is believed to work better than aloe gel or a placebo.

Psoriasis vulgaris: The initial evidence suggests that psoriasis vulgaris may be effectively treated with an extract from aloe in the form of a hydrophilic cream. However, it is strongly recommended against it as additional research is needed in this area.

Seborrheic dermatitis: Seborrheic dermatitis causes stubborn dandruff and the skin on the scalp to become inflamed, scaly and itchy. Aloe vera lotion may be an effective treatment, according to initial studies.

Cancer prevention: Evidence suggests that aloe consumed orally may reduce the risk of developing lung cancer. However, it is unclear if it is the aloe itself or other factors that may provide this benefit.

Dry skin: Aloe vera plant health benefits have been extolled for decades. The moisturizing qualities of aloe, and its consequent capacity to effectively reduce skin dryness are backed by early, low-quality scientific evidence. To be sure of its healing powers, higher quality studies are required.

Lichen planus: This common skin disease results in an itchy, swollen rash on the skin or in the mouth. The scientific evidence suggesting that aloe may be a safe, helpful treatment for lichen planus, is limited. There is need for additional research.

Skin burns: Initial evidence form scientific investigations suggest that aloe may assist the healing of mild to moderate skin burns. Additional proof is required to confirm this fact.

Skin ulcers: Among the aloe vera benefits for skin is the likelihood of its ability to help heal skin ulcers with local application. These conclusions have been arrived at through early studies, which still leaves the need for high-quality studies comparing aloe alone with placebos.

Ulcerative colitis: While research regarding benefits of aloe vera in treating ulcerative colitis (UC) is limited, nonetheless, the results are promising. It is yet to be understood how aloe vera measures up to other treatments used for UC.

Wound healing: The results on aloe vera's wound healing properties are conflicting. While some studies say that it has a positive effect, others report that there are no improvements, and at times potential worsening of the condition. Further study is required to establish its exact effect.

Among the other therapeutic uses of aloe vera, it is said to sooth skin irritation caused by prolonged exposure to the sun's radiation. There is insufficient evidence to support claims of the use of aloe vera to treat mucositis, diabetes and HIV infection. Aloe vera juice benefits are often advertised with regards to treating heartburn and irritable bowel syndrome. It is also common practice for cosmetic companies to include extacts from Aloe vera in their products. While aloe vera plant proves to be extremely beneficial for the hair and the skin, to truly harness its powers, it is important to know how to use the plant. It is the transparent fluid exuded by the inner leaf wherever it is cut or crushed, that must be applied to the hair or skin, for it is this substance that is said to have soothing, moisturizing properties.
